Compare Valrico to Ocala

This post compares Valrico, Florida to Ocala, Florida across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Valrico (CDP) Ocala (city)
Population 37,546 57,812
Income (median) $52,717 $36,374
Home Value (median) $211,200 $121,800
White 81% 73%
Black 8% 19%
Asian 4% 2%
With Kids 36% 27%
Age (median) 41 38
Rentals 17% 48%
